    Jessica M.

    I saw a tiktok video featuring this taco place and knew I had to try it. It seems I drive right by this place everyday on my way to work. Their hours are 7am-2pm which are also my work hours. Today I managed to make it 20 minutes before they closed. The women that took my order was very friendly! I ordered the beef fajita taco on a flour tortilla and a carnival taco on corn. Both were fresh and made to order. SO good. I also got to try the green and red sauce. I liked both. I was happy to hear breakfast is served all day. I can't wait to try this place again. I just read a review that they only accept cash. I might have missed the signs but happened to pay with cash anyway. Also, there are no prices listed on the menu. Just ask.

    Jasmin M.

    I stopped by on a Saturday morning and ordered 8 tacos. Heads up: there are no prices listed on the menu, and my total came out to $31. The wait was rough -- 41 minutes for my order. It seems like a lot of people call in big orders, so I'd definitely recommend ordering ahead if you plan to go. Unfortunately, the tacos weren't worth that kind of wait.

    Parking can be a pain at Armadillo Den but the chicken sandwich is definitely worth a try. Find a…read moreseat inside to enjoy the great recommendation from the friendly staff. Would try something else from their menu on my next visit but enjoyed the sandwich on this visit.

    Biggie's Yardbird sits inside Armadillo Den, the beer-garden-plus-food-trailers spot, which is…read morehonestly a very cool setup. Tons of picnic tables, a big bar for drinks, and even a little fountain you can sit by. Great place to hang out. I ordered the smash burger. It was... fine. Not bad at all, just not in my top tier of Austin smash burgers. The patty came out in pieces, which happens when it gets smashed a little too thin. Totally edible, still tasted good, it just didn't have that cohesive patty feel or the crispy lacy edges I like. I ordered through the QR code on the table, which told me it would take about 30 minutes, but it was ready in 10. Not complaining, but it's always funny when the system just picks a random long estimate and then surprises you. Fries were adequate, nothing memorable. Service was okay. I asked for a side of their special sauce, and the guy looked totally baffled, like no one in the history of burgers had ever asked for sauce on the side. Someone else behind him finally said, "I think he means the Biggie sauce." Now I know what to call it if I ever return. Overall: decent burger, not amazing, but Armadillo Den itself is a great hang. I wouldn't come back specifically for this burger, but I'd happily eat it again if I was already there with friends.
